AI Avatars: The Brand New Teacher Assistant

AI avatars are designed to be supplementary tools, working alongside educators to create more personalized and engaging learning environments. These digital assistants can handle routine tasks, freeing up valuable time for teachers to focus on what they do best: inspiring students, providing nuanced guidance and crafting impactful lessons.

By taking on responsibilities such as answering common questions or providing additional explanations on basic concepts, AI avatars allow teachers to dedicate more attention to complex teaching tasks and one-on-one interactions with students who need extra support.

Enhancing Student Engagement

One of the key benefits of AI avatars being used in education systems is their potential to boost student engagement. Research shows that when interacting with emotionally responsive digital characters with a face, students often feel more at ease and motivated to participate. This increased engagement can lead to better retention of information and more effective learning outcomes.

However, it is again crucial to note that this technology doesn't aim to replace the irreplaceable human connection between teacher and student. Instead, it provides an additional channel for engagement, particularly beneficial for students who might be hesitant to speak up in a traditional classroom setting or who need to study from home. It also has its place in catching up from sick days etc.

Personalized Learning Support

AI avatars can assist teachers in providing more personalized learning experiences. They can adapt to individual learning styles and paces, offering tailored explanations and exercises. This feature is especially valuable in large classrooms where teachers might struggle to provide individualized attention to every student.

By handling some aspects of personalized instruction, AI avatars allow teachers to better identify and focus on students who need more specialized attention or different teaching approaches.

What is the Future of Education?

As we look to the future of education, it's clear that the most effective approach will be one that combines the strengths of both human teachers and AI technology. AI avatars have the potential to handle routine tasks, provide additional support and offer personalized learning experiences.

However, as already mentioned, they cannot replace the critical role of teachers in providing emotional support, complex problem-solving guidance and the kind of nuanced understanding that only human interaction can provide.

The integration of AI avatars in education represents an opportunity to empower teachers, not replace them. By providing educators with advanced tools to enhance their teaching capabilities, we can create more effective, engaging and personalized learning environments.

As we continue to develop and implement this technology, the focus should remain on how it can best serve both teachers and students, ensuring that the irreplaceable human element of education remains at the forefront of our educational systems.
